Output a50fc893f4f8e132922f4ebc379c85fa1f81d0afde5390f31c78e0581f091799:25

value
18336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0d87685fd28d26923f5d71633eaecb613e253c2 OP_EQUAL
address
3GMVMM9scJUKboKgC4tVxWnkCwmMxcYB8t
transaction
a50fc893f4f8e132922f4ebc379c85fa1f81d0afde5390f31c78e0581f091799
confirmations
258122
spent
true